Output 8e8966121c5fe1f7cab607e1805c992edeaeae245c1dbb8f86af6804235370c6:0

value
1658100
script pubkey
OP_0 OP_PUSHBYTES_20 4252f359370ce8a6ff966a9ffecd9dd9fe2803f3
address
bc1qgff0xkfhpn52dlukd20lanvam8lzsqlnjuk8gv
transaction
8e8966121c5fe1f7cab607e1805c992edeaeae245c1dbb8f86af6804235370c6
confirmations
44814
spent
true